- Overall management of the Loss Prevention Department and it's functions.
- Co-ordinate implement and monitor loss control procedures throughout the hotel.
- Training all Loss Prevention Supervisor and Officers.
- Conduct regular inspections throughout the hotel and report findings to the Executive Committee and relevant Department Heads.
- Prepare regular security reports for hotel management.
- Document security incidents, investigations, and resolutions.
- Liaise good relationship will locally police and Fire Fighter.
- Establish and maintain goals and objectives for the Security Fire Prevention and Safety program.
- Prepare reports recommendations and surveys in a timely manner or security fire prevention and safety program for hotel use.
- Co-ordinate and monitor the Hotel's Key Control Procedures and system.
- Implement personal development program for members of the Loss Prevention Department coordinated through the Training Manager.
- Conduct generic training for departments, i.e. fire prevention, CPR, security awareness, safety awareness and safety committee.
- Investigate all incidents or complaints and report to Executive Assistant Manager.
- Participate as an active member of the safety committees.
- Prepare cost effective and efficient rosters.
- Undertake Loss Prevention Officer duties, if needed.
- Undertake other duties/tasks as directed.
- Ensure that Safety program are observed, maintained and enforced.
